Works and Estates - Projects Officer (1 Post)

JOB BRIEF
Manage all construction and repair and maintenance projects in respect of project team, contract administration and implementation plans in the Works and Estates division. Reports to the Pro Vice Chancellor

Key Result Areas
Coordinate construction of the University Campus
Bidding for construction services
Secretariat to Building Committee of Council
Works and Estate management

Responsibilities
Overseeing the total construction operations of Women’s University in Africa up to projects delivery in accordance with specified designs, budgets and programmes.
Executing the preliminary planning and organizing of each new contract allocated
Coordinating with the Project Managers prior to the scheduled dates of commencement of sub-contractor’s work to ensure that sub-contractors are tied into the master programme.
Leading the Project Managers, Site Agents/Managers and General Foremen in preparation and participation in the budget, cost evaluation of the work to be done.
Authorizing plant requisitions to ensure such items requested fall within the estimated budget revisions and control.
Ensuring effective procurement and delivery of materials in accordance with the material schedules prepared for each contract.
Meeting all constructional operations standards of quality as required by Industry on Quality Control, Safety, Health and Environment.
Roads designs and construction (civil, mechanical and electrical)
Visiting every contract to determine and assess operating effectiveness including quality of workmanship and all aspects of site administration and control.
Ensuring that all legal statutory and contractual requirements are complied with and that Women’s University in Africa policies and routines are followed on cases of personnel, purchasing, banking, accounting, invoicing, ordering, dealing with cash, materials accounting and payment of employees.
Preparation of tender documents
Bill of quantities preparation and Payment Certificates
 

Duties and Responsibilities:
Formulate, analyse and recommend designs proposals and prepare drawings in liaison with internal and external stakeholders i.e. consultants, financiers, contractors, Government Ministries and all law enforcement agencies for approval.
Develop the divisional budgets and monitor expenditure and provide leadership on project cost control
Generate monthly/Quarterly/Annual divisional reports
Manage the WUA estate issues in close liaison with the tenants and Landlords
Attend Head of division and committee meetings and servicing the Building Committee and sub-committee meetings
Manage WUA Infrastructure facilities in respect of the environment grounds maintenance, repairs and maintenance
Manage of the WUA security systems
Manage WUA Vehicle fleet
Manage the division staff
Any other tasks as delegated

Work/Educational Requirements

Possession of a degree/diploma in an Engineering discipline, Surveying, Building Management or Construction Economics from a reputable institution.
A minimum of 5 years experience at senior management level
Knowledge and experience of PPP’s will be added advantage
Must have worked on construction site as Foreman, Agent or Contracts Manager

Attributes

Focused/ innovative and practical
Able to motivate and organize an effective construction workforce
Able to schedule project work and work within budget
Knowledge of construction
